Ingredients
6 large eggs
1 cup milk
1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ar, mozzarella, or your choice)
1 cup diced vegetables (spinach, bell peppers, onions, or mushrooms)
1/2 cup cooked and crumbled bacon or sausage (optional)
Salt and pepper to taste
Cooking spray or oil for greasing the muffin tin
Directions
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a muffin tin with cooking spray or oil.
- Mix the Filling: In a large bowl, whisk together the eggs and milk. Stir in the cheese, diced vegetables, and cooked meat if using. Season with salt and pepper.
- Fill the Muffin Tin: Pour the mixture evenly into the greased mu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full.
- Bake: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and bake for 20 minutes or until the quiche cups are puffed and lightly golden.
- Cool and Store: Once done, allow them to cool in the tin for a few minutes before carefully removing. Store any leftovers in the fridge or freezer for later.

Key Prep Tips
- Use Muffin Tins: Line a muffin tin with non-stick spray or silicone liners for easy removal and cleanup.
- Whisk the Eggs Thoroughly: Beat eggs with milk or cream for a fluffy texture and consistent flavor.
- Pre-Cook Add-Ins: Sauté vegetables like spinach, mushrooms, or bell peppers to remove excess moisture before adding to the quiche cups.
- Don’t Overfill: Leave a small gap at the top of each muffin cup as the quiches will puff slightly while baking.
Suggested Variations
- Protein Additions: Include cooked bacon, sausage, ham, or tofu for a protein boost.
- Cheese Options: Use cheddar, Swiss, feta, or a plant-based cheese for a flavorful twist.
- Spice It Up: Add red pepper flakes, smoked paprika, or a pinch of nutmeg for extra depth.
- Crust Option: Add a layer of phyllo dough, puff pastry, or a slice of bread at the bottom for a crusty base.
